    After many sleepless nights, hundreds of dollars spent, our baby girl is home and okay!

    We got a tip on her 9/15/2006 at around 5pm. A guy had cornered her and she jetted off as soon as she noticed she was cornered. He called our home but only my brother and my mother were here - my father and I were out passing out flyers.

    So my brother went into the neighborhood she was spotted. She is a bit scared of him because he isn't around much. He left his truck running in the middle of the road as soon as he spotted her. He tried getting her to come to him but she kept shying away. She was limping but still ran full force. He chased her for about 2 miles until she ran off into the woods.


    During this time my dad and I had arrived home and go the message at around 7pm. We searched and searched the area from 7pm to about 2:30am. We put out food, dirty shirts of our's and some water hoping she'd return to that area and eat. Dad went out this morning ( I actually slept well last night, I'm not sure why) and checked the food. It wasn't touched.
    So he walked around the area. He found some feces in the middle of the road, all it had in it was grass and bugs, and it was cold. He still went back into that area and called her name.


    He heard her yiping. He spotted her across the way but she would not come to him. She kept ducking around and yiping. As my dad got closer he realized she couldn't get to him because there was a fence. She jumped up on the fence and he grabbed her.


    He carried her back to the truck. He said the whole way home she was whining, making noises and kissing him. She NEVER gives kisses - NEVER.
    Dad and her finally arrived home. He awoke me from my nightmare as he came into my room and put her on my bed. "Kay, LOOK WHO I GOT!!!" It was my little girl and she was HOME. She gave me kisses all over too and I hugged her tighter than I ever have before.


    If it weren't for the support of our online and offline community she would not be home. The wonderful family who spotted her in their neighborhood and called us - they are heavensent.
